From ec3d504674ce7929d78afe757833ee5a097230ee Mon Sep 17 00:00:00 2001 From: Peter Hanssens Date: Fri, 5 Sep 2025 01:21:51 +1000 Subject: [PATCH] feat: Update main package to use published v0.6.0 dependencies for context-menu, dropdown-menu, menubar - Main package now uses published dependencies for 31 components - Ready to publish main leptos-shadcn-ui v0.6.0 package --- Cargo.lock | 52 ++++++++++++++++++++++++++-- packages/leptos-shadcn-ui/Cargo.toml | 6 ++-- 2 files changed, 52 insertions(+), 6 deletions(-) diff --git a/Cargo.lock b/Cargo.lock index da56c1f..1373dc0 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-1974,6 +1974,20 @@ dependencies = [ "web-sys", ] +[[package]] +name = "leptos-shadcn-carousel" +version = "0.6.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"762d9ac24b6f3319d65339a4a56adc214aad2d5b5fc5b7c153fb3fee3cc0adaa" +dependencies = [ + "leptos", + "leptos-node-ref", + "leptos-struct-component", + "leptos-style", + "tailwind_fuse 0.3.2", + "web-sys", +] + [[package]] name = "leptos-shadcn-checkbox" version = "0.6.0" @@ -2045,6 +2059,21 @@ dependencies = [ "web-sys", ] +[[package]] +name = "leptos-shadcn-combobox" +version = "0.6.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"f0bc91d3283ff4ca693082b24859932bc103ae479737ebc84eefe05fc0e17379" +dependencies = [ + "gloo-timers", + "leptos", + "leptos-struct-component", + "leptos-style", + "tailwind_fuse 0.1.1", + "wasm-bindgen", + "web-sys", +] + [[package]] name = "leptos-shadcn-command" version = "0.6.0" @@ -2216,6 +2245,23 @@ dependencies = [ "web-sys", ] +[[package]] +name = "leptos-shadcn-form" +version = "0.6.0"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"700fbfe0b0bb419c1641c61af2574ec276da1adc3e9eab418f38fd10139f9dcd" +dependencies = [ + "gloo-timers", + "leptos", + "leptos-shadcn-button 0.2.0", + "leptos-shadcn-input 0.2.0", + "leptos-struct-component", + "leptos-style", + "tailwind_fuse 0.1.1", + "wasm-bindgen", + "web-sys", +] + [[package]] name = "leptos-shadcn-hover-card" version = "0.6.0" @@ -2791,10 +2837,10 @@ dependencies = [ "leptos-shadcn-button 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)", "leptos-shadcn-calendar 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)", "leptos-shadcn-card 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)", - "leptos-shadcn-carousel", + "leptos-shadcn-carousel 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)", "leptos-shadcn-checkbox 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)", "leptos-shadcn-collapsible 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)", - "leptos-shadcn-combobox", + "leptos-shadcn-combobox 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)", "leptos-shadcn-command 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)", "leptos-shadcn-context-menu", "leptos-shadcn-date-picker 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)", @@ -2802,7 +2848,7 @@ dependencies = [ "leptos-shadcn-drawer", "leptos-shadcn-dropdown-menu", "leptos-shadcn-error-boundary 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)", - "leptos-shadcn-form", + "leptos-shadcn-form 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)", "leptos-shadcn-hover-card", "leptos-shadcn-input 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)", "leptos-shadcn-input-otp", diff --git a/packages/leptos-shadcn-ui/Cargo.toml b/packages/leptos-shadcn-ui/Cargo.toml index 49fddce..206b8ac 100644 --- a/packages/leptos-shadcn-ui/Cargo.toml +++ b/packages/leptos-shadcn-ui/Cargo.toml @@ -56,9 +56,9 @@ leptos-shadcn-command = { version = "0.6.0", optional = true } leptos-shadcn-input-otp = { path = "../leptos/input-otp", version = "0.6.0", optional = true } leptos-shadcn-breadcrumb = { version = "0.6.0", optional = true } leptos-shadcn-navigation-menu = { path = "../leptos/navigation-menu", version = "0.6.0", optional = true } -leptos-shadcn-context-menu = { path = "../leptos/context-menu", version = "0.6.0", optional = true } -leptos-shadcn-dropdown-menu = { path = "../leptos/dropdown-menu", version = "0.6.0", optional = true } -leptos-shadcn-menubar = { path = "../leptos/menubar", version = "0.6.0", optional = true } +leptos-shadcn-context-menu = { version = "0.6.0", optional = true } +leptos-shadcn-dropdown-menu = { version = "0.6.0", optional = true } +leptos-shadcn-menubar = { version = "0.6.0", optional = true } leptos-shadcn-hover-card = { path = "../leptos/hover-card", version = "0.6.0", optional = true } leptos-shadcn-aspect-ratio = { version = "0.6.0", optional = true } leptos-shadcn-collapsible = { version = "0.6.0", optional = true }